zimochandAndrew Johnson 4d63e65b9d fdManager changed to use poll()
The implementation using select() limits file desciptors to FD_SETSIZE,
typically 1024 on Linux. This number is too low for some applications,
for example for the CA gateway.
Therefore, Linux builds use poll() instead.

Érico NogueiraandAndrew Johnson 21368dc7b4 Don't include linux/ header in osdSockUnsentCount.
Per the manpage in the file's comment, SIOCOUTQ is equivalent to the
TIOCOUTQ ioctl, whose value can be obtained by including <sys/ioctl.h>,
which allows us to avoid including any system-specific headers. This is
desirable so that, on a musl system, it won't be necessary to install
kernel headers in order to build epics-base.

Since it's first been checked into Git, the Linux kernel has defined
SIOCOUTQ to be TIOCOUTQ [1].

From the three main libc options on Linux: glibc and uclibc use the
kernel headers, so both ioctls are available; and musl defines only
TIOCOUTQ in their own headers.

zimochandAndrew Johnson b97a35fec8 Don't use __attribute__((noreturn)) on VxWorks
VxWorks does not mark abort() or exit() as noreturn.
Thus, functions declared noreturn which end in a call
to those functions cause a compiler warning on vxWorks.
